Ares went to Mount Olympus to be healed by his father, Zeus. After recovering, Ares returned to the battlefield and fought with Athena to avenge her. However, Athena managed to defeat Ares by attacking him with a large rock. 5. Roman name Ares. In Roman mythology, Ares is known as Mars, the god adapted from Etruscan mythology. At first, Mars was more known as the god of agriculture than the god of war. But everything changed when the Roman power grew stronger and stronger. The name Mars was also later used as the name of the 4th planet in the solar system. The two moons that orbit the planet Mars are also named after the two guardians of Ares, Phobos and Deimos.

Here are some prominent examples: Roman: Mars: The Roman god of war, agriculture, and fertility. He was associated with the planet Mars due to its red colour, which was seen as a symbol of blood, battle, and vitality. Greek: Ares: The Greek equivalent of Mars, also associated with war, violence, and masculinity. Egyptian: Horus: The Egyptian god of kingship, the sky, and protection. He was sometimes depicted with the head of a falcon, and the red colour of Mars was associated with his fiery eyes.
